The purpose of the Urenco Chemical Processing Operations
Materials Technical Specifier is to support the Plant’s reliability
program through the provision of Critical spares. This will be
delivered by providing a professional and thorough analysis of the
critical equipment list and developing detailed technical
specifications for spare parts to be procured by the Materials
Department.
The Chemical processing Operations Materials
Technical Specifier works as part of the Plant Reliability team to
ensure the seamless provision of critical spare parts onto stock The
role is days based. This a critical role to ensure the correct
technical specification of spare parts for Production Critical
equipment as well as recommended stock holding, re-order points etc
and definition of Bills of Materials for critical equipment.
Compliance with all Urenco procurement protocols will be a key part of
the role.
The role holder will be expected to work within the
procurement tracking system supported by the Materials team. The role
holder will specify the correct QA grading for the materials being
specified, and then fill in the appropriate stock holding request
forms for procurement of items to stock.
The Materials Technical
Specifier is deeply imbedded within the Plant Reliability Team, their
role is critical to ensure the seamless provision of critical spare
parts as stock items. The role of the Materials Technical Specifier is
to update/ produce accurate technical specifications of all mechanical
“Critical Equipment” for procurement, ensuring all of Urenco’s
compliance requirements are met (Quality Grading, Materials & Test
Certification, Regulatory, etc).

Accountability
- The update of existing and generation of new Electrical and
Instrumentation equipment technical specifications for procurement
- Site walk downs to ensure that the “As installed” equipment aligns with the documentation within the Urenco document management system. Where discrepancies exist escalate to the engineering department.
- Make initial contact with vendors to
identify availability of spares, escalating to Engineering department
if change management processes need to be followed
-
Determine the correct Quality Grading Level in line with the Urenco
Capenhurst Standards and ensure the requirements for that level are
met including test certification
- Generation of Material
Master documentation to UCP agreed standards
- Update
Technical Basis of Maintenance documentation to reflect the spares
holding to UCP agreed standards
- Ensure materials on high
hazard critical duties are specified to comply with the correct
standards and legislation (DSEAR, PSSR, PUWER, LOLER, SIL etc)
